Public international law: humanitarian law
Sorting
Bestseller Sorting collapsed

product_type_E-book
Price
23.09 £ * Old Price 32.99 £

product_type_E-book
Price
23.00 £


product_type_E-book
Price
49.00 £


product_type_E-book
Price
59.49 £ * Old Price 84.99 £



product_type_E-book
Price
109.50 £

product_type_E-book
Price
51.09 £ * Old Price 72.99 £


product_type_E-book
Price
104.00 £


product_type_E-book
Price
43.39 £ * Old Price 61.99 £